NASA Stennis Finishes Secret Test Structure Water Supply Upgrade

.For virtually 60 years, NASA's Stennis Room Facility has checked spacecraft units and engines to assist electrical power the country's human room expedition dreams. Completion of a crucial water supply facilities job assists ensure the web site can easily proceed that frontline work moving on.
" The framework at NASA Stennis is completely vital for rocket engine testing for the organization as well as business business," said NASA job supervisor Casey Wheeler. "Without our high pressure industrial water system, testing carries out certainly not happen. Putting up brand new underground piping restores the lifespan and also gives the facility an unit that may be run for the not far off future, so NASA Stennis can easily contribute to its own nearly 6 decades of payments to space exploration attempts.".
The high tension industrial water supply supplies numerous thousands of quarts of water per min through underground pipelines to cool down spacecraft motor exhaust and offer fire reductions capacities throughout testing. Without the water flow, the engine exhaust, arriving at as hot as 6,000 levels Fahrenheit, can melt the examination position's steel blaze deflector.
Each test position likewise features a FIREX device that proves out in reserve for use in the event of an incident or even fire. Throughout SLS (Space Release Device) primary stage screening, water additionally was used to produce a "curtain" around the exam hardware, moistening the higher degrees of noise generated during warm fire and lowering the video-acoustic influence that can trigger damage to structure and also the exam hardware.
Prior to the body upgrade, the water flow was actually delivered by the site's authentic piping facilities built in the 1960s. Nonetheless, that facilities had properly surpassed its own counted on 30-year lifespan.

Extent of the Job.
The succeeding water supply upgrade was prepared around various periods over a 10-year period. Teams functioned around ever-changing exam routines to complete 3 primary tasks representing greater than $50 million in infrastructure investment.

Crews started by substituting sizable sections of piping, consisting of a 96-inch line, coming from the 66-million-gallon onsite storage tank to the Thad Cochran (B-1/ B-2) Test Stand. This stage also consisted of the setup of a brand-new 25,000-gallon electric pump at the Higher Stress Industrial Water Facility to improve water flow ability. The upgrades were actually important for NASA Stennis to carry out Environment-friendly Operate testing of the SLS core phase in 2020-21 in front of the effective Artemis I release.
Operate in the An Examination Facility adhered to with crews switching out segments of 75-inch piping from the water vegetation and putting in a number of new 66-inch gateway valves..
In the final period, workers used an impressive strategy to install brand new steel linings within existing pipelines bring about the Fred Haise Exam Stand up (previously A-1 Exam Stand up). The job observed NASA's completion of a prosperous RS-25 engine examination project last April for future Artemis goals to the Moon as well as past. The stand right now is actually being readied to start screening of brand new RS-25 trip engines.
Generally, the piping project embodies a substantial upgrade in design and materials. The new piping is actually brought in from carbon steel, along with protective coatings to stop deterioration and gate valves created to become more heavy duty.

Value of WaterIt is actually tough to overstate the usefulness of the job to guarantee on-going water flow. For a common 500-second RS-25 motor exam on the Fred Haise Examination Remain, around 5 million quarts of water is actually supplied coming from the NASA Stennis tank with a quarter-of-a-mile of pipeline just before going into the platform to offer the deflector and cold motor exhaust.
" Without water to cool down the deflector and the vital portion of the exam endure that will get hot from the hot fire on its own, the test stand will need recurring rehabilitative servicing," Wheeler pointed out. "This device makes certain the examination endures continue to be in a condition where continuous screening may happen.".
